  Paper Title

PACKET LOSS REDUCTION ROUTING PROTOCOL FOR MOBILE AD-HOC NETWORK USING NODE DENSITY METHOD

  Authors

  Achu Anna Antony,  Bino Thomas

  Keywords

MANET, routing protocol, neighbour node, node density strategy, packet loss.

  Abstract


Mobile Ad-hoc NETwork (MANET) is an anxious self-shaping, framework less system of mobile networks in a remote association. As there is a high climb in the utilization of cell phones and remote systems over past years, MANET has become one of the vital networks used for communication. A routing protocol is utilized for dispersing data that permits choosing routes between two nodes in a system. Packet loss is one of the significant issues that occur in the mobile ad- hoc networks while routing. A packet comprises the unit of information which is steered amongst source and destination in a system. Packet loss happens when at least one packet crosswise over systems in a network drop before achieving the destination node. A node density strategy is proposed in this paper to ease the packet loss issue to a degree. Because of system framework of MANET progressively changes, portable specially appointed system is exceptionally helpless against assaults. Concerning the security reason, we utilize RSA encryption calculation, the keys are sent to all hubs inside a system, the message is encoded and sent to the destination node.
